What is remote entry?

Remote entry jobs are positions that involve performing data entry or administrative tasks from a location outside of a traditional office, usually from home. These jobs typically require entering, updating, or managing data using computers and various software programs. Remote entry roles are popular for their flexibility and are often found in industries like healthcare, finance, and customer service. Candidates need basic computer skills, attention to detail, and reliable internet access. Employers may require specific software knowledge or previous experience, depending on the job.

What challenges do remote entry-level employees face, and how can they be overcome?

Remote entry-level employees often encounter challenges such as staying motivated without in-person supervision, building relationships with colleagues remotely, and managing time effectively. To overcome these, it's important to establish a structured daily routine, proactively communicate with your team using available digital tools, and take initiative in seeking feedback or clarification when needed. Many companies also offer virtual onboarding and mentorship programs to help new remote employees integrate smoothly and feel supported.

What skills and qualifications are needed for remote entry?

To thrive as a Remote Data Entry Clerk, you need strong attention to detail, fast and accurate typing skills, and proficiency in basic computer applications, typically requiring a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with spreadsheet software (like Microsoft Excel or Google Sheets), data management systems, and sometimes remote collaboration tools is essential. Reliability, time management, and self-motivation are crucial soft skills for working independently in a remote setting. These skills ensure accuracy, productivity, and effective communication, which are critical for maintaining data integrity and meeting deadlines.

The Litigation Docketing Manager is responsible for leading the firm's litigation docketing operations, including team oversight, quality control, technology administration, and process improvement. Reporting to the Director, Litigation Docketing, this role ensures the accurate and timely calculation, entry, review, and communication of litigation deadlines and court dates across federal, state, local, appellate, administrative, and specialty courts. The manager leads docketing professionals, partners with attorneys and legal support teams, and serves as a resource on docketing procedures, court rules, and deadline-related risk management.

On a typical day you will:

  • Manage the litigation docketing team, including workload distribution, training, quality review, feedback, and professional development.
  • Oversee the calculation, entry, review, maintenance, and reporting of litigation deadlines, court dates, filing dates, discovery deadlines, appellate deadlines, and related events.
  • Develop and improve docketing policies, procedures, workflows, checklists, best practices, and quality control standards.
  • Serve as a resource for attorneys and staff on court rules, local practices, deadline calculations, and docketing protocols.
  • Monitor court rule and procedure changes and update docketing practices and reference materials as needed.
  • Review docket reports for accuracy, completeness, and timely communication of critical deadlines.
  • Assist Director with administering docketing platforms, including calendaring rules, reporting, user adoption, data accuracy, troubleshooting, and vendor coordination.
  • Support software updates, enhancements, testing, implementations, and system conversions in coordination with docket team, IT, vendors, practice groups, and end users.
  • Deliver training on docketing procedures, software functionality, workflows, and best practices.
  • Maintain procedures, training guides, workflow documentation, internal communications, and reference resources.
  • Manage escalations involving complex deadline calculations, court notices, disputed dates, and advanced rules analysis.
  • Maintain confidentiality and professionalism when handling sensitive client, matter, personnel, and firm information.
